Summerhill Vets News -Animal Welfare Act.
- A suitable environment
- A suitable diet
- To be able to behave normally
- To be house with or apart from other animals (whichever is best)
- To be protected from pain suffering and disease
These five “rights” are part of the new animal welfare act which came into force recently. The aim of the Act is to reduce the incidence of suffering by prevention rather than cure. Legislation is in place to ensure that early intervention can reduce the suffering of all animals (not just farm animals)
The Act also contains new legislation on the tail docking of dogs.
